Street Fighter II has the honor of being one of the greatest fighting games ever. Just think about some of the things the game brought to gaming. Street Fighter II helped revitalize arcades, made fighting games popular, and helped spawn such games as Darkstalkers, Street Fighter IV, and Marvel vs series would have never been made.
